Client Accounting and Advisory Services (CAAS) is a fully integrated financial model, not a collection of separate services. When you work with Finvera, everything is delivered together by one accountant who understands your business.

This is fundamentally different from hiring a bookkeeper for one task and a CFO for another. Finvera’s certified public accountant services connect your day-to-day accounting directly to your long-term strategy.

CaaS accounting stands for Client Accounting and Advisory Services. It is an integrated model that combines bookkeeping, financial reporting, and CFO advisory into one service. Instead of separate providers, everything works together to give you accurate numbers and better business decisions.

Traditional CPA services focus on compliance such as tax filings and year-end reporting. CAAS accounting goes further by providing ongoing financial reporting, KPI tracking, and advisory. The goal is to help you make decisions, not just stay compliant.
